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:35 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 6 pieces b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 4 cloves gar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 medium yellow onion, thinly sliced
  • 2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 0.75 cup kalamata olives, pitted
  • 0.5 cup chicken broth
  • 0.5 cup dry white wine
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on fresh oregano leaves
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ice

Directions

Step 1

Pat the chicken thighs dry with paper towels and season them on all sides with salt, pepper, and paprika.

Step 2

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ken thighs, skin side down, and sear for 5-6 minutes until the skin is golden brown and crispy. Flip and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es. Transfer the chicken to a plate and set aside.

Step 3

Reduce the heat to medium and add the remaining tablespoon of olive oil to the skillet. Add the minced garlic and sliced onions, cooking for 2-3 minutes until fragrant and softened.

Step 4

Stir in the halved cherry tomatoes and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the tomatoes begin to release their juices.

Step 5

Add the kalamata olives, chicken broth, and white wine. Stir to combine and bring the mixture to a simmer.

Step 6

Nestle the seared chicken thighs back into the skillet, skin side up. Spoon some of the sauce over the chicken and reduce the heat to medium-low. Cover the skillet and let it simmer for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ked (internal temperature of 165°F or 74°C).

Step 7

Uncover the skillet and stir in the fresh parsley, oregano, and lemon juice. Let everything cook for another 2 minutes to combine the flavors.

Step 8

Serve the Mediterranean chicken hot with your favorite side dish, such as couscous, rice, or crusty bread. Garnish with extra parsley if desired.
